More about Certificate IV in Leisure and Health

If you are looking to enhance your career in the growing field of leisure and health, obtaining a Certificate IV in Leisure and Health in Yeppoon is an excellent choice. This qualification equips you with the skills and knowledge required for various roles in the community services sector, including positions such as a Diversional Therapy Assistant, Disability Support Worker, and Lifestyle Coordinator. By choosing to study locally, you can access face-to-face learning opportunities at esteemed institutions, such as the Royal College of Healthcare, which offers a structured Traineeship delivery mode for this qualification.

The Certificate IV in Leisure and Health is closely aligned with various industries that contribute significantly to our communities. The course intersects with Business courses, Community Services courses, and Healthcare courses, providing a broad foundation for diverse career paths. Additionally, this qualification is relevant to emerging roles such as a Diversional Therapist or a Wellness Coordinator. Engaging in these studies not only prepares you for direct client engagement but also positions you for leadership roles within the Aged Care and Disability sectors.
